RoCE技术在HPC中的应用分析.docx
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
RoCE(RDMA over Converged Ethernet)技术是高性能计算(HPC)领域中的一个重要解决方案,它通过在以太网上实现远程直接内存访问(RDMA),显著提升了网络性能。RoCE的诞生源于对更高带宽、更低延迟和更好拥塞控制的需求,尤其是在HPC集群中。传统的以太网解决方案无法满足这些需求,而诸如Myrinet、Quadrics和InfiniBand等定制网络技术曾是主流。随着RoCE和RoCEv2协议的推出,以太网得以在HPC领域中重新获得关注。 RoCE协议分为两个版本:RoCE v1和RoCE v2。RoCE v1是一个链路层协议,仅限于同一二层网络内的通信,数据包无法被三层路由,限制了其扩展性。相比之下,RoCE v2是网络层协议,它引入了UDP和以太网的网络层,允许数据包被路由,从而提高了网络的可扩展性。 RoCE技术的关键优势在于其RDMA功能,它将数据传输的工作卸载到网卡上,减少了CPU的负担和数据包处理的开销,降低了通信延迟。RoCEv2协议通过使用IP层的DSCP和ECN字段实现拥塞控制,确保无损传输,这对于RDMA通信至关重要,因为任何丢包或数据包乱序都会导致重传,影响效率。 无损网络是RoCE应用的基础,RoCE的拥塞控制机制包括DCQCN和PFC两阶段。DCQCN通过交换机标记IP层的ECN字段来通知发送方减缓速率,而PFC则通过暂停传输来避免缓冲区溢出。这种精细的拥塞控制策略确保了网络资源的有效利用,避免了丢包,从而保障了高效率的HPC通信。 RoCE技术在HPC中的应用分析显示,尽管InfiniBand等专有网络技术仍然占据一定地位,但RoCE的普及使得以太网在HPC领域的地位得到巩固。随着技术的进步,RoCE有望在更多场景下替代传统网络解决方案,推动HPC网络性能的进一步提升。在未来,RoCE可能成为构建大规模、高性能计算集群的标准通信协议之一。
剩余12页未读,继续阅读
- 走开你胖到我了2024-09-25总算找到了自己想要的资源,对自己的启发很大,感谢分享~
- 粉丝: 8498
- 资源: 2万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助